Ali H. Bashal is a scholar working on Materials Chemistry, Polymers and Plastics and Electrical and Electronic Engineering. According to data from OpenAlex, Ali H. Bashal has authored 53 papers receiving a total of 560 ind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Materials Chemistry, 14 papers in Polymers and Plastics and 11 papers in Electrical and Electronic Engineering. Recurrent topics in Ali H. Bashal’s work include Dielectric properties of ceramics (9 papers), Conducting polymers and applications (8 papers) and Ferroelectric and Piezoelectric Materials (8 papers). Ali H. Bashal is often cited by papers focused on Dielectric properties of ceramics (9 papers), Conducting polymers and applications (8 papers) and Ferroelectric and Piezoelectric Materials (8 papers). Ali H. Bashal collaborates with scholars based in Saudi Arabia, Egypt and India. Ali H. Bashal's co-authors include Khaled D. Khalil, Mohamed A. El‐Atawy, Sayed M. Riyadh, T. A. Abdel–Baset, Jeenat Aslam, Nagi R.E. Radwan, Ahmed M. Abu‐Dief, Talaat Habeeb, Walaa Alharbi and Khadijah H. Alharbi and has published in prestigious journals such as Green Chemistry, International Journal of Biological Macromolecules and Journal of Physics and Chemistry of Solids.
